Due to a lack of funding, the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P) will end after April 2024. Low …Feb 20, 2024 · Spectrum Internet Assist. Spectrum Internet Assist functions similarly to the Comcast program and requires families to have a child eligible for the NSLP. The service offers a free modem and a 30 Mbps connection. Wi-Fi costs $5 extra per month with this plan. To apply for Spectrum Internet Assist, visit the Spectrum Assist website. Cox ... Most Lifeline participants, as well as other low- and moderate-income households, are eligible to receive an internet service discount of up to $30 per month (up to $75 for residents of Tribal lands) under the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P). Eligible households can also receive a one-time discount of up to $100 to purchase a laptop ...New customers will receive 60 days of complimentary Internet Essentials service, which is normally available to all qualified low-income households for $9.95/ ...

The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P) is a federal government program that provides a discount on monthly high-speed internet service bills for qualifying low-income households. ACP launched at Metro by T-Mobile on January 27, 2022. What is the Affordable Connectivity Program? The ACP is a government assistance program that helps connect households to the internet they need for work, healthcare, school and more. Qualifying households are eligible for free or low-cost internet service through credits up to $30 per month. Low-Income Broadband Pilot Program. Spectrum is proud to participate in the federal and certain state Lifeline programs in its RDOF areas. Lifeline is a government-assistance program, under which, Spectrum offers discounts on Home Phone and Internet service for qualified low-income households.
